SPU: Four-year letterwinner. ... NCAA All-West Region in 2018 and 2019. ... All-GNAC in 2019. ... GNAC All-Academic in 2017, 2018, and 2019. ... USTFCCCA All-Academic in 2018 and 2019.
Senior (2019): Ran in and scored in all six meets. ... Raced to her best-ever finish at the GNAC Championships, placing 2nd behind Alaska Anchorage's Emmanuelah Chelimo on a snow-covered course in Billings. Finished the 6 kilometers in 21 minutes, 39.25 seconds. The 2nd place was her highest-ever finish in any college meet... Ran 8th overall (and No. 2 for the Falcons) at the NCAA West Regionals in Monmouth with a time of 20:59.4 -- the first sub-21 of her career. It also was her second straight top-10 Regional finish. ... Placed No. 2 for SPU and 51st overall at the NCAA Championships in Sacramento, stopping the watch in 21:10.2.
Junior (2018): Ran and scored in all seven meets. ... Led the way for the Falcons with a 10th-place finish at the NCAA West Regionals, helping the team secure 4th place and ultimately earn a trip to nationals. Finished the 6K regional course at Amend Park in Billings, Mont., in 21:34.11.... Ran No. 2 for the team (12th overall) at GNAC in 22:06.80 for 6K at Western Oregon's Ash Creek Preserve. ... Placed 3rd for the team (120th overall) at nationals on a rainy, muddy day in Pittsburgh, clocking 24:32.6 for 6K at Schenley Park. ... Placed No. 2 for SPU in the first three regular-season meets, including 3rd overall at the CWU Invite, 21st at the Charles Bowles Invite, and 11th at the Inland Empire Championships. Her time of 17:49.0 at the Bowles made her one of three Falcons that day to break 18 minutes after only one other Falcon in the entire history of the program had gone sub-18 on the 5K layout at Bush's Pasture Park in Salem, Ore.
Sophomore (2017): Ran five meets, scoring in four of them. ... Placed No. 4 for SPU and 24th overall at GNAC Championships on Oct. 21, breaking 23 minutes at Lake Padden Park for the first time (22:59.36). ... Finished No. 6 for the team and 88th overall at NCAA West Regionals. ... Was the third Falcon across the finish line and 28th overall at Sundodger on Sept. 16, beating 23 minutes for the first time in college with a 22:35.83. ... Also scored at the Charles Bowles Invitational (No. 5 SPU, 26th overall) and at the Western Washington Classic (No. 4 SPU, 35th overall).
Freshman (2016):Â Ran in all five meets. Scored at Humboldt State Invitational (No. 5 for SPU, 22nd overall) and at Saint Martin's Invitational (No. 4 for SPU, 6th overall). ... Ran No. 7 for Falcons (40th overall) in GNAC Championships at Lake Padden. ... Ran No. 6 for Falcons (155th overall) at NCAA West Regionals in Billings, Mont.
Hazen High School: Ran twice at the Class 3A (medium-large school) Washington state meet. After placing 120th as a junior in 21:26.28, made a huge climb as a senior in 2015, moving all the way up to 44th and dropping more than a 90 seconds off of her time, finishing the 5 kilometers in 19:50.3. ... Took 3rd in both the Seamount League and West Central District meet as a senior. ... On the track, went to 3A state in the 800 as a sophomore (15th in 2:24.96), junior (11th in 2:20.65) and senior (6th in 2:16.74). ... Also was 6th in the state 1600 as a senior with her first-ever sub-5 (4:57.76). ... Ran the second leg on the 3rd-place state 4x400 relay as a senior. ... Set an 800-meter PR of 2:14.83 as a senior in 2016.
